WAXWORK RECORDS UNVEILS DELUXE 2020 SUBSCRIPTION

Wednesday, December 11, 2019 | Announcement

By CARLING KIRBY

Just in time for the holiday’s, Waxwork Records has announced the launch of their 2020 Records Subscription, which is now available for purchase online. The year 2020 marks the fifth consecutive year of Waxwork Records’ subscription service, which offers remastered soundtracks and film scores on vinyl, newly-released cover art and high quality packaging.

Subscribers will receive five 180 gram coloured vinyl soundtracks, exclusive merchandise, apparel, a 10% discount on any merchandise with the Waxwork label, and giveaways throughout 2020, including an entry to win a U-Turn Audio Orbit Special Turntable ($550 Value).

Waxwork Records has also significantly lowered its prices for both domestic and international customers on the 2020 Subscription: $200 for U.S. Customers and $250 for Canadian and international customers.

These five exclusive soundtracks are the following:

  • Henry: Portrait of a Serial Killer (LP), available for the first time on vinyl since the highly limited 1990 picture disc release. This issue is a special collaborative effort between Waxwork and all three of the film’s composers, Steven A. Jones, Robert McNaughto and Ken Hale. The full original soundtrack has been sourced directly from the composers’ archives.
  • Friday the 13th Part VII: The New Blood (2xLP), part of a series of Friday the 13th vinyl releases from Waxwork Records. Composed by Fred Mollin, this is the first time the soundtrack for Friday the 13th Part VII: The New Blood has been released in any format. Working closely with Paramount Pictures, Waxwork located and transferred the original 1988 master tapes of the score.
  •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les Part II: The Secret Of The Ooze (LP), a follow-up to Waxwork Records’ 2017 release of the original 1990 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les Composed by John DuPrez, this is the first time the soundtrack has been released in any format. The vinyl was sourced from the original 1991 master tapes with the help of Nickelodeon and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les co-creator Kevin Eastman.
  • Friday The 13th Part VIII: Jason Takes Manhattan (2xLP), composed by Fred Mollin and released for the first time in any format. Waxwork once again collaborated with Paramount Pictures and transferred the original 1989 master tapes containing the full score music. This vinyl includes hard rock single “The Darkest Side of the Night” by Metropolis, which was featured in the film.
  • Jacob’s Ladder (LP), composed by Maurice Jarre and available for the first time since the film’s release in 1990. Like the other vinyls on the list, this one was sourced from its original master tapes.
